Welcome to Shimla, the capital city of Himachal Pradesh and a popular honeymoon destination. Spend the morning exploring the scenic beauty of Shimla Ridge and Mall Road. In the afternoon, visit Jakhu Temple and enjoy panoramic views of the city. In the evening, take a romantic walk along The Ridge, admiring the sunset and the stunning architecture of Christ Church.
Travel to Manali, a picturesque hill station known for its scenic beauty and adventure activities. Start your day with a visit to Hadimba Devi Temple and enjoy the serene surroundings.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ant markets of Manali and indulge in shopping for local handicrafts. In the evening, take a romantic stroll along the banks of the Beas River and enjoy the breathtaking sunset.
Head to Dharmsala, the spiritual home of the Dalai Lama and a place known for its Buddhist heritage. Start your day with a visit to the Namgyal Monastery and experience the tranquility of the surroundings. In the afternoon, explore the Tibetan Museum and learn about the Tibetan culture and history. In the evening, take a leisurely walk through the picturesque tea gardens of Kangra Valley.
Travel to Dalhousie, a charming hill station nestled in the Dhauladhar mountain range. Start your day by visiting the Khajjiar Lake, often referred to as the "Mini Switzerland of India." Enjoy the serene surroundings and indulge in some adventure activities. In the afternoon, explore the quaint streets of Dalhousie and visit St. John's Church. In the evening, take a romantic walk along the scenic Bakrota Hills.
Continue exploring the beauty of Dalhousie by visiting the Chamera Lake in the morning. Enjoy boating and the serene ambiance of the lake. In the afternoon, take a trip to the Kalatop Wildlife Sanctuary and spot diverse flora and fauna. In the evening, visit the Satdhara Falls and immerse yourself in the natural beauty of the cascading water.
Return to Shimla and spend the day enjoying its charm. In the morning, explore the picturesque town of Kufri and indulge in adventure activities like horse riding and skiing. In the afternoon, visit the Indian Institute of Advanced Study and gain insights into India's colonial past. In the evening, take a romantic stroll along the charming streets of Shimla and soak in its romantic ambiance.
After a memorable honeymoon, it's time to bid farewell to Himachal Pradesh. Depart from Shimla with beautiful memories and a heart full of love.
For a unique experience, consider a visit to the Tirthan Valley near Manali. It offers serene landscapes, crystal-clear rivers, and opportunities for trekking and trout fishing. Another offbeat destination is the village of McLeod Ganj near Dharmsala, which is home to the Tibetan government-in-exile and offers a blend of Tibetan and Indian cultures. Both destinations provide a peaceful and romantic atmosphere for honeymooners.
